## Activities & Attractions
- **Galveston Island Historic Pleasure Pier**: A classic Gulf Coast boardwalk with rides, games, and sweeping ocean views, Galveston Island Historic Pleasure Pier blends nostalgic charm with high-energy fun. It’s a great pick for families, couples, and anyone who loves amusement parks by the water.
- **Palm Beach At Moody Gardens Water Park**: Palm Beach at Moody Gardens is a tropical escape with Galveston’s only private white-sand beach, a lazy river, wave pool, and towering slides. It’s ideal for families and anyone wanting a fun, laid-back summer day by the water.
- **Historic Downtown Strand Seaport Partnership**: Step into Galveston’s beautifully preserved historic district, where Victorian architecture, waterfront views, and lively shops and restaurants bring the past to life. It’s perfect for history lovers, shoppers, and anyone who enjoys a scenic stroll with a touch of old-world charm.
- **Aquarium At Moody Gardens**: Step into a towering underwater world at the Aquarium Pyramid, where sharks, penguins, stingrays, and colorful fish create a memorable experience. It’s a great pick for families, animal lovers, and anyone who enjoys immersive marine life displays.
- **Galveston Railroad Museum**: Step aboard a historic rail yard filled with vintage locomotives, restored train cars, and hands-on exhibits at the Galveston Railroad Museum. It’s a memorable stop for train fans, history lovers, and families looking for a fun, one-of-a-kind experience.
- **Galveston's 61st Street Fishing Pier**: Galveston’s 61st Street Fishing Pier is a classic Gulf-side spot where families, anglers, and sunset watchers can enjoy easygoing pier fishing, snacks, and ocean views. Its laid-back, all-ages atmosphere makes it especially appealing for a relaxed day on the water.
- **Rosenberg Library**: A historic Galveston landmark, Rosenberg Library offers a welcoming mix of books, events, and local history in a beautiful setting. It’s a great stop for families, history lovers, and anyone who enjoys community-friendly spaces.
- **Moody Mansion**: Step into Galveston’s grand Moody Mansion, a beautifully restored Victorian-era home filled with original furnishings and rich history. It’s a great stop for history lovers, architecture fans, and anyone who enjoys a glimpse into Texas’s gilded past.
- **Moody Gardens Attractions Theme Park**: Explore three glass pyramids packed with aquariums, rainforest wildlife, and hands-on science, all in one family-friendly Galveston destination. It’s a great pick for animal lovers, curious kids, and anyone who enjoys a mix of learning and adventure.
